You are marooned on a frictionless horizontal plane and cannot exert any horizontal force by pushing against the surface.How can you get off
Options
(a) by jumping
(b) by rolling your body on the surface
(c) by splitting or sneezing or throwing any object
(d) by throwing an object in opposite direction
Correct Answer:
by throwing an object in opposite direction
